React Native Awesome Button:打造动态交互按钮

React Native Awesome Button:打造动态交互按钮

react-native-awesome-buttonA button React Native component supporting showing different states with animations项目地址:https://gitcode.com/gh_mirrors/re/react-native-awesome-button

在移动应用开发中,按钮是用户交互的核心元素之一。一个优秀的按钮组件不仅能够提升用户体验,还能增强应用的视觉吸引力。今天,我们要介绍的是一款名为 React Native Awesome Button 的开源项目,它能够帮助开发者轻松创建具有动态交互效果的按钮。

项目介绍

React Native Awesome Button 是一个基于 React Native 的按钮组件,它允许开发者定义按钮在不同状态下的外观和行为。通过简单的配置,你可以实现按钮在点击、加载、成功等状态之间的平滑过渡和动画效果。

项目技术分析

技术栈

  • React Native:用于构建跨平台的移动应用。
  • JavaScript/JSX:用于组件的逻辑和渲染。
  • CSS-in-JS:通过样式对象定义按钮的外观。

核心功能

  • 状态管理:按钮可以在不同的状态(如默认、加载、成功)之间切换。
  • 动画过渡:状态切换时,按钮的外观会平滑过渡。
  • 自定义样式:支持通过属性自定义按钮的背景、文本和图标样式。
  • 事件处理:可以为每个状态定义不同的点击事件处理函数。

项目及技术应用场景

React Native Awesome Button 适用于以下场景:

  • 表单提交:在用户提交表单时,按钮可以显示加载状态,提交成功后显示成功状态。
  • 登录/注册:在用户登录或注册时,按钮可以显示不同的状态,如加载、成功或失败。
  • 操作确认:在用户执行重要操作(如删除数据)时,按钮可以显示确认状态。

项目特点

动态交互

React Native Awesome Button 允许你为按钮定义多个状态,并在这些状态之间进行平滑的动画过渡。这不仅提升了用户体验,还增强了应用的视觉吸引力。

高度可定制

通过简单的属性配置,你可以自定义按钮的背景颜色、文本样式、图标位置等。这使得按钮能够完美融入你的应用设计。

易于集成

只需几行代码,你就可以将 React Native Awesome Button 集成到你的项目中。项目提供了详细的安装和使用指南,即使是新手也能快速上手。

活跃的社区支持

作为一个开源项目,React Native Awesome Button 拥有一个活跃的社区。你可以通过提交问题、贡献代码或参与讨论来帮助项目不断改进。

结语

React Native Awesome Button 是一个强大且灵活的按钮组件,它能够帮助你轻松实现动态交互效果,提升应用的用户体验。无论你是新手还是经验丰富的开发者,这个项目都值得一试。赶快加入 React Native Awesome Button 的社区,开始打造你的动态按钮吧!


如果你对 React Native Awesome Button 感兴趣,可以访问项目的 GitHub 页面 了解更多信息。

react-native-awesome-buttonA button React Native component supporting showing different states with animations项目地址:https://gitcode.com/gh_mirrors/re/react-native-awesome-button

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

咎岭娴Homer

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值